In a test to indicate whether or not an unknown solution is an aldehyde or ketone, explain how the unknown solution is one or the other (or something else) based on each of the seven test results/observations combined below:

Odor = plastic

Solubility (in water) = not soluble

DNHP Test (Brady's Test) = positive

Tollen's Test = negative

Feihling's Test = negative

Iodoform Test = negative

Chromic Acid Test = negative
